Aerial Reconnaissance Officers of the 425th Skala Separate Assault Regiment Repel Russian Saboteurs in Close Combat

Aerial reconnaissance officers of the 425th Skala Separate Assault Regiment engaged in close combat with a Russian sabotage and reconnaissance group that infiltrated the rear to eliminate Ukrainian UAV operators.

The press service of the 425th Skala Separate Assault Regiment published the footage of the battle.

The group of Russian saboteurs wrapped themselves in yellow tape to disguise themselves as Ukrainian soldiers and infiltrated deeper into the positions in search of drone operators in the Pokrovsk sector.

The invaders entered the settlement and surrounded a partially destroyed building where the drone control point and operators of the 425th Regiment were located. This was immediately reported to the command, which alerted the adjacent units about the threat.

Nearby, several other UAV pilot groups were operating and decided to support their surrounded comrades. A 48-year-old soldier with the call sign “Ecologist,” along with two other operators, grabbed assault rifles and went into battle while the other groups provided drone support.

“By their accent, it was clear that they were a sabotage and reconnaissance group. Our guys were in the basement, and they were in the yard. I didn’t hesitate to go; if we hadn’t made it in time, the guys would have died,” Ecologist, a fighter from the 425th Skala Separate Assault Regiment, shared.

Ukrainian FPV drones began actively targeting the enemy saboteurs, forcing them to hide in one of the buildings. This allowed three Ukrainian fighters to approach the buildings and throw grenades at the enemy group.

After the saboteurs in the building fell silent, the Ukrainian soldiers managed to free two surrounded pilots from the basement and, under drone cover, safely evacuate them from the danger zone.

Russian military forces are actively using sabotage and reconnaissance groups for operations in the Ukrainian rear, aimed at undermining the capabilities of the Defense Forces. These are mostly groups that infiltrate through the northern border, but such attempts continue even in active combat areas.

In December last year, the Special Operations Forces neutralized one of these groups that was trying to infiltrate the Sumy region through the border settlement of Myropillia.

The enemy was detected in time by a reconnaissance drone accompanying them, and then drones with ammunition were directed at them.

The tactics of sabotage groups are also used by Ukrainian special forces, with their priority operational area in recent months being the Kursk operational zone. In early December, fighters from the 8th Separate Special Purpose Regiment lured a platoon of Russian marines in armored vehicles into an ambush by requesting reinforcements on behalf of captured invaders.

This same SOF group raided into the enemy’s rear and captured enemy positions, eliminating seven invaders and taking eight more prisoners in the Kursk region.
